On this episode of The Author Factor Podcast  I am having a conversation with business strategist and author, Beate Chelette.

Beate is the Growth Architect and provides visionaries with clear steps to improve business systems to maximize profits and scale impact.

A first-generation immigrant with $135,000 in debt, Beate bootstrapped her passion for photography into a global business and sold it for millions to Bill Gates.

Beate is the author of the #1 International Award-Winning Amazon Bestseller Happy Woman Happy World – How to Go from Overwhelmed to Awesome.

The book that corporate trainer and best-selling author Brian Tracy calls “a handbook for every woman who wants health, success and a fulfilling career.”
